If You See A Purple Butterfly Sticker Near A Newborn, You Need To Know What It Means

Millie and Louis experienced the devastating loss of one of their twins, Skye, due to anencephaly. In response to their heartbreaking journey, they founded the “Skye High Foundation” and initiated the purple butterfly initiative.

The purple butterfly stickers, introduced in NICU units globally, serve as a silent symbol of loss for families who have lost one of their babies in a multiple birth. This initiative aims to prevent unintentionally hurtful comments and provide support during an already challenging time.

Despite their inability to change Skye’s fate, Millie and Louis offer support through support groups and initiatives like the purple butterflies. Their ultimate goal is to ease the burden for parents facing similar heartbreaking journeys.

Millie emphasizes the importance of support groups and initiatives like the stickers, acknowledging that while they can’t prevent such tragedies, they can provide solace and understanding to those in need.
